About Bendle Middle School

Located at 2294 E BRISTOL RD, in BURTON, Michigan, Bendle Middle School is an intimate middle-grades school that enrolls 219 students (grades 6 through 8), one of the schools within Bendle Public Schools. Compared to the state average of about 502 students per school, that is 56% below typical.

Across the 4 schools in Bendle Public Schools (981 students total), Bendle Middle School accounts for its share of the district's footprint.

For racial and ethnic makeup, Bendle Middle School lists that White students make up the majority at 67%. Beyond that, the school shows 14% Hispanic, 12% multiracial, 8% Black.

Looking at school resources, Staff filings list 17 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 13.0:1 students per teacher. That figure is tighter than the state norm's 17.5:1 average. An estimated 91% of students are eligible for free or reduced-price lunch, often used as a Title I proxy. By comparison, Genesee County runs at roughly 61%, so the school's eligibility rate is higher than the surrounding baseline.

Across the wider county, community-level numbers for Genesee County indicate median household income runs about $62,281, 23%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and the poverty rate sits near 12%. Across Genesee County's 158 public schools (combined enrollment of about 58,534 students), Bendle Middle School is one campus in the mix.

Bendle High School is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.3 miles from this campus. 8 of the 8 nearest public schools sit inside a five-mile radius.

Geographically, the school is in a commuter-belt area.

Looking at the recent track record. Bendle Middle School's enrollment has edged down 19% since 2018, when it stood at 271 (now 219). Over the same period, the White share declined from 75% to 67%. The student-to-teacher ratio narrowed from 21.2:1 in 2018 to 13.0:1 today.
